Responding to risk and regulation - polishing your extra-legal skills
Facing an unrelenting stream of further regulation and associated risk of falling into non-compliance, the workload of today's corporate counsel has never been greater. With such scrutiny comes the necessity to re-evaluate operational structures, reporting lines and compliance programmes whilst simultaneously being asked to do ‘more with less'. Further, in response to the continuing drift away from operating in a purely legal capacity, in-house lawyers must now also equip themselves with a host of new management skills.
